About Rice crunch

Rice Crunch is a delightful snack inspired by Asian cuisine, often crafted from puffed or crispy rice and bound together with light sweeteners like honey or brown sugar. Some variations include mix-ins such as nuts, seeds, or dried fruits, enhancing the texture and flavor profile while providing additional nutrients. Known for its satisfying crunch, this treat is naturally gluten-free and low in fat, making it a potential guilt-free option for snackers. Nutritionally, Rice Crunch offers quick energy due to its carbohydrate content and can provide fiber and protein depending on added ingredients. However, some versions may include higher sugar levels or processed additives, so moderation is key. Perfect as an on-the-go snack or addition to a light meal, Rice Crunch combines simplicity with a taste that appeals across generations.
